Turkmen National Leader, Azerbaijani Economy Minister Review Expanding Bilateral Cooperation

Economy

Ashgabat, The Gulf Observer: National Leader of the Turkmen people and Chairman of the Halk Maslahaty of Turkmenistan, Gurbanguly Berdimuhamedov, on Tuesday reaffirmed Turkmenistan’s commitment to further strengthening strategic ties with Azerbaijan during a meeting with Azerbaijani Minister of Economy Mikayil Jabbarov, who is on a working visit to the country.

During the meeting, Mikayil Jabbarov conveyed warm greetings and best wishes from Azerbaijani President Ilham Aliyev and expressed gratitude for the warm hospitality extended by the Turkmen side. He said Azerbaijan highly values the steadily growing interstate relations with Turkmenistan and praised the country’s remarkable socio-economic progress and the modern architectural development of Ashgabat.

Gurbanguly Berdimuhamedov thanked the Azerbaijani minister for the greetings and asked him to convey his best wishes to President Ilham Aliyev. He underscored that relations between the two neighboring and friendly countries continue to deepen on the basis of mutual respect, good-neighborliness and longstanding historical ties.

The National Leader noted that his previous high-level visits to Azerbaijan had opened a new chapter in Turkmen-Azerbaijani relations, while regular dialogue between the leadership of both countries continues to provide fresh momentum to bilateral cooperation across multiple sectors.

The two sides highlighted the successful collaboration between Turkmenistan and Azerbaijan both bilaterally and within international organizations, particularly the United Nations, emphasizing their shared commitment to regional stability and constructive international engagement.

Berdimuhamedov also praised the outcomes of the recent state visit of President Serdar Berdimuhamedov to Azerbaijan and reiterated his appreciation for the vessel “Dostluk”, presented by Azerbaijan as a gift to the Turkmen people.

The meeting also underscored the importance of cultural and humanitarian cooperation, with both sides noting the successful organization of the Days of Culture of Turkmenistan in Baku and Ganja, as well as the Days of Culture of Azerbaijan in Ashgabat and Arkadag.

The National Leader further highlighted ongoing preparations for the international environmental event “Ene-tebigat” (Mother Nature), scheduled to be held in Turkmenistan from October 19 to November 30. The event will be jointly organized by the Heydar Aliyev Foundation and the Gurbanguly Berdimuhamedov Charity Fund for Assistance to Children in Need of Guardianship.

At the conclusion of the meeting, Berdimuhamedov and Jabbarov expressed confidence that Turkmen-Azerbaijani relations would continue to expand across political, economic, cultural and humanitarian fields, and exchanged wishes for good health, happiness and continued success.
